(247NEWSSOURCE/LEARFIELD/PACKER) – The Green Bay Packers continue their training camp schedule.
Green Bay linebacker Quay Walker and cornerback Micah Robinson returned to the field Thursday after being activated from the physically unable to perform list.
Packers coach Matt LaFleur talked about Walker passing his physical.
LaFleur said that he was happy with Day 1 of practice.
The Packers will play their first preseason game at home against the Jets on August 9.

Packers throwback uniforms look way back: The Packers throwback uniforms will be a tribute to the first time stock in the team was sold.
A Green Bay team first took the field in 1919, but the stock was sold four years later in 1923 to keep the team operating.
Sports Illustrated reports that this time, the alternate jerseys will be navy blue with dark gold numbers and dark blue stripes.
That’s what the Packers were wearing 102 years ago.
The throwback helmets will be painted to look like the leather helmets that players wore a century ago.
It’s not known when those uniforms will be used in a game, but it will be at Lambeau Field.
